The University of Waterloo in Canada has a computer engineering degree, but many students opt for a computer sciences degree.
However, as students move up the academic career ladder, computer science is increasingly becoming a top choice for students who want to pursue a career in computer science.
And, there’s evidence that a computer engineer’s background is linked to a better understanding of technology.
But, what’s the best way to learn to program in computer?
Read moreComputer science is an area of research that combines math, science and engineering.
In the field, the focus is on how computers work and how they interact with other things.
A computer science degree aims to prepare students for this technical side of computer engineering, and that includes the use of algorithms and programming languages like Python and Ruby.
Computer science programs can be divided into three different areas: theoretical and applied, experimental and applied.
In theory, computer scientists build software systems that can perform certain types of tasks.
Theoretical computer science focuses on computer systems that are capable of performing a certain task, such as finding a path through a maze.
Applied computer science concentrates on software systems, which can be used in different situations, such for example for making an app that detects a location and lets you know whether to take a detour.
In practice, students often spend a semester or two in either of these two areas before they start learning to program.
But, how do you apply computer science to real-world problems?
In this section, we will explore the different aspects of computer science that can be applied to real world problems.